Ok so I have a kguard system at home that has an app you can use to view cameras when not at home.

What I first did was give my DVR a static IP
Then I forwarded ports for that IP on my Router.
I then created a free account with No IP to get a DNS name because I did not have a static IP for my house.
Then just inserted all the info into the Kguard App and now I can view my cameras from anywhere.
The No-IP also lets you install an application that will update the site when your DHCP IP changes, this ensures your cameras are always accessible.

Let me just put it out there that you do NOT want to just forward a port to the internet, and rely on the authentication performed by the DVR to keep your stuff private/safe.

So many DVR systems have been shown to be backdoored, compromised, vulnerable in various ways, etc, that I would only ever put something like that behind some strong authentication, such as a VPN or SSH tunnel.
